The Opera stands as a testament to Gothic Revival architecture, a striking presence on the Upper West Side. Completed in 1930, this 23-story building houses 113 units, offering a blend of historical charm and modern living. Originally built as a church and later transformed into a hotel, The Opera's rich history adds a unique character to its façade. Its pointed arches and elaborate stone detailing create a distinctive aesthetic that sets it apart in a neighborhood known for its architectural diversity.

There's a reason New York City has been the backdrop of countless films, novels, and lifelong ambitions; it simply does things at a scale and intensity that no other place in the country matches. Spread across five distinct boroughs — Manhattan, Brooklyn, Queens, the Bronx, and Staten Island — NYC offers wildly different ways to experience daily life depending on where you plant your roots. Whether you're drawn to the electric pace of Midtown, the tree-lined streets of Park Slope, or the arts-forward energy of Astoria, each corner of the city carries its own character and cadence.

The rental landscape here is as varied as the city itself. Sleek high-rise apartment communities with floor-to-ceiling skyline views define much of Midtown and the Financial District, while pre-war lofts and historic brownstones dominate neighborhoods like SoHo, the West Village, and Park Slope.
